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3582361906 1474600 2656139799 7238 61623936124
862011 170
862011 170
050713665 78249436614 5175037
All about undefined
Interested in learning more?
862011 170
050713665 78249436614 5175037
See more
4060888 860
8409 1442 375260171 107172692
See more
1959 730364 2780053
7950091384 4405713527 34
See more